"I'd much rather have sat there and just been a fly on the wall, instead of having to smile at people. I'd rather have been a waitress. Just gone round and stared at people"
About this Quote
The waitress detail is the sharpest twist. Waitressing is actual service work, yet she imagines it as freer than celebrity mingling. Why? Because it comes with a script and a task. You can move, observe, and even judge, all under the cover of usefulness. “Just gone round and stared at people” is funny because it’s impolite to the point of absurdity, but it’s also an honest description of what comics do: they watch, clock the micro-rituals, harvest the awkwardness.
Contextually, it reads like a glimpse behind a public event - awards, parties, the kind of room where everyone is networking with their teeth showing. Saunders punctures that sheen. Her intent isn’t to confess shyness; it’s to insist that the real comedy is in the room, not in the performance of being delighted to be there.
